Free Water - Refill in Knutsford

So you have your reusable water bottle with you.  But what happens when you are out and about and you have drunk all your water?  You could fill up from the sink in the loos, or ask in a café…  Or look out for the blue circular Refill sign. 

I love this as an idea and concept, and luckily Knutsford signed up last summer.  These signs are scattered about in the windows of: shops, jewellers, cafes, hairdressers, printers, florists the list goes on.  What I love is it is a mix of local independent businesses and national shops that have joined the scheme.   A town of free water. 



Are you in a town with a Refill Scheme?  Download the app to find out.  Or get your town involved.  This is an international scheme which aims to make it easy, convent and cheap to fill up your water bottle.  And more than anything brings another level of awareness about the use of single use plastic bottles.


The idea behind the scheme from Refill:
"Currently, less than 30% of people in the UK drink tap water in a reusable bottle, despite the fact that we are lucky to have some of the best quality, free drinking water in the world.
Refill makes refilling a reusable water bottle easy, fun and more socially acceptable than buying a single-use plastic drinks bottle. We aim to stop millions of plastic bottles at source each year, preventing plastic pollution from entering our rivers and sea.
There is simply no need to buy bottled water, and we’re on a mission to inspire social change."
